What are the key skills and qualifications needed to thrive as a Bioinformatics Intern, and why are they important?

To thrive as a Bioinformatics Intern, you need a foundation in biology and computer science, often supported by coursework or a degree in bioinformatics, computational biology, or a related field. Familiarity with programming languages like Python or R, and experience with bioinformatics tools such as BLAST, Galaxy, or Next-Generation Sequencing (NGS) analysis platforms are typically required. Strong analytical thinking, attention to detail, and effective communication skills help interns interpret data and collaborate with research teams. These skills are crucial for accurate data analysis, meaningful scientific contributions, and successful teamwork in fast-evolving research environments.

What are bioinformatics scientists?

Bioinformatics scientists are professionals who use computational tools and techniques to analyze and interpret biological data, such as DNA, RNA, and protein sequences. They work at the intersection of biology, computer science, and mathematics to support research in areas like genomics, drug discovery, and personalized medicine. Their work often involves developing algorithms, managing large datasets, and creating software to facilitate biological research.

How does a Bioinformatics professional typically collaborate with researchers and laboratory scientists on projects?

Bioinformatics professionals often work closely with researchers and laboratory scientists to interpret complex biological data, such as sequencing results or gene expression profiles. Collaboration involves understanding the scientific goals, designing computational analyses, and translating data into meaningful insights. Regular meetings, clear communication, and iterative feedback are common, ensuring that computational work aligns with experimental needs. This teamwork helps bridge the gap between raw data and actionable scientific discoveries.

What You'll Do

As a Diagnostic Associate I, you will support the laboratory's diagnostic and surveillance efforts through molecular testing, sequencing analysis, quality assurance activities, and research support. Key responsibilities include:

  • Perform molecular diagnostic procedures including DNA and RNA extraction, PCR, Sanger sequencing, and next generation sequencing.
  • Analyze sequencing data, assemble gene sequences from raw data, generate phylogenetic trees, and conduct bioinformatic analyses to support diagnostic testing and disease surveillance programs.
  • Evaluate incoming samples for quality and suitability, verify test results, monitor quality control measures, and investigate unexpected or inconsistent findings.
  • Collaborate with diagnostic associates, faculty, laboratory staff, and national surveillance partners to support animal disease monitoring and reporting efforts.
  • Assist with research and development projects by supporting test development activities, organizing research samples, and providing technical expertise for ongoing laboratory initiatives.
  • Requires strict adherence to established safety and quality standards.
  • Provides opportunities to build expertise in molecular diagnostics, sequencing technologies, and bioinformatics applications.
  • Involves high volume sample processing and requires strong attention to detail.
  • The ability to distinguish colors accurately is necessary for interpreting laboratory results and ensuring compliance with safety protocols.
